Python初学者必备:10个简单有趣的Python程序示例

更新时间:2024-05-07 分类:网络技术 浏览量:1

对于Python初学者来说,学习编程最重要的是要动手实践。通过编写一些简单有趣的Python程序,不仅可以巩固基础知识,还能培养编程思维,提高编码能力。下面我们就来看看10个非常适合Python初学者练手的小程序吧。

1. 摄氏温度转华氏温度

这是一个非常基础的Python程序,可以帮助你熟悉变量、输入输出、简单计算等基础知识。程序会提示用户输入摄氏温度,然后计算并输出相应的华氏温度。

2. 计算圆的面积和周长

这个程序会提示用户输入圆的半径,然后计算并输出圆的面积和周长。通过这个程序,你可以学习如何使用数学公式进行计算,并熟悉Python中的数学函数。

3. 简单的计算器

这个程序模拟了一个简单的计算器,可以进行加、减、乘、除四则运算。用户只需输入两个数字和运算符,程序就会自动计算并输出结果。这个程序可以帮助你学习条件语句、循环语句等基础知识。

4. 猜数字游戏

这是一个非常经典的Python小游戏。程序会随机生成一个1到100之间的数字,玩家需要猜这个数字是多少。如果猜错,程序会提示玩家是高了还是低了,直到猜对为止。这个程序可以帮助你学习随机数生成、条件语句等知识。

5. 石头剪刀布游戏

这个程序模拟了经典的石头剪刀布游戏。程序会随机生成一个选择,玩家需要输入自己的选择,然后程序会判断输赢并输出结果。这个程序可以帮助你学习条件语句、随机数生成等知识。

6. 倒计时程序

这个程序会提示用户输入一个倒计时的时间,然后程序会每隔一秒输出剩余的时间,直到倒计时结束。这个程序可以帮助你学习时间操作、循环语句等知识。

7. 生成随机密码

这个程序会根据用户的要求,生成一个随机的密码。用户可以指定密码的长度和包含的字符类型(数字、大小写字母、特殊字符等)。这个程序可以帮助你学习字符串操作、随机数生成等知识。

8. 简单的聊天机器人

这个程序模拟了一个简单的聊天机器人。用户可以输入问题,程序会根据关键词给出相应的回答。这个程序可以帮助你学习字符串操作、条件语句等知识。

9. 文件读写程序

这个程序可以帮助你学习如何使用Python读写文件。程序会提示用户输入文件名,然后根据用户的选择执行读取或写入操作。这个程序可以帮助你学习文件操作相关的知识。

10. 简单的网页爬虫

这个程序可以帮助你学习如何使用Python进行网页爬取。程序会提示用户输入一个网址,然后抓取该网页的HTML内容并输出。这个程序可以帮助你学习网络编程相关的知识。

通过编写这些简单有趣的Python程序,Python初学者不仅可以巩固基础知识,还能培养编程思维,提高编码能力。希望这些程序示例对你有所帮助,祝你学习Python顺利!